Davido's Album at No 1 in US iTune

‘Timeless’ album by the Nigerian Afrobeats singer, Davido Adeleke known by his stage name as Davido becomes the first African Album to hit No 1 on US iTune in history.

VerseNews Nigeria reports that the ’17 tacks’ album sets its record to rank No 1 in the world’s biggest music market after it topped the chat on Wednesday, April 5, 2023.

Davido’s Timeless album becomes the first African album to top the US iTunes Albums Chart.

“It is also the highest charting African album on US Apple Music with a peak of no. 2.
” – Africa Facts Zone (@AfricaFactsZone) April 5, 2023 reports.

This Online News Media reported that the Singer will release his fourth studio album ‘Timeless’ on March 31, 2023 after a long time break in social medias and his music career.

The comeback album features Nigerian artists such as Asake, Fave, The Cavemen, Morravey and Logos Olori. Angelique Kidjo.

British rapper in the song is Skepta, South African music producer/DJ Musa Keys, Jamaican dancehall/reggae singer Dexta Daps, and South African rapper, Focalistic.

This Online News Media reports that the album following release has made waves across different music platforms with global streaming giant, Spotify announcing it the most streamed in the United Kingdom, Canada, France and Nigeria.

It also made history as the most first-day after it reaches over 6 million streams in few hours for an African album on Apple Music.
